**1. A Blue Oasis in Space**

Earth, often referred to as the "Blue Planet," is the only known celestial body to host life. Its vibrant, life-sustaining ecosystems range from lush rainforests to barren deserts, creating a rich tapestry of biodiversity. This extraordinary diversity of life includes millions of species, each playing a unique role in the intricate web of existence.

**2. The Dance of the Elements**

Earth's dynamic geology showcases the power of nature in action. Volcanoes erupt with molten fury, sculpting the landscape over millennia. Earthquakes shake the ground, a reminder of the planet's ever-shifting tectonic plates. These forces, while formidable, have also given rise to breathtaking landscapes, from the Grand Canyon's majestic depths to the towering peaks of the Himalayas.

**3. The Symphony of Climate**

Earth's climate is a complex symphony of winds, currents, and temperatures. The oceans absorb and release vast amounts of heat, shaping global weather patterns. The result is a kaleidoscope of climates, from the freezing expanses of Antarctica to the scorching deserts of the Sahara. This climate diversity sustains unique ecosystems and cultures across the planet.

**4. The Magic of Biodiversity**

Earth's biological diversity is nothing short of astounding. From the microscopic organisms in a drop of water to the magnificent elephants roaming the savannahs, life takes on countless forms. The intricate interplay of species, their adaptations, and their habitats is a testament to the planet's resilience and creativity.

**5. The Aquatic Mysteries**

The oceans, covering over 70% of Earth's surface, are teeming with mysteries waiting to be unraveled. Coral reefs, often called the "rainforests of the sea," harbor a multitude of species, while the deep ocean conceals creatures with adaptations that defy imagination. Earth's waters have inspired countless explorers and continue to reveal secrets of the deep.

**7. The Celestial Ballet**

Earth is not alone in its celestial dance. The moon, our constant companion, has shaped our tides and even our cultures. The night sky, with its stars and planets, has fueled human imagination for millennia, guiding our exploration of the universe beyond our home planet.

**8. The Miracles of Water**

Water, the lifeblood of our planet, is itself a miracle. It exists in three states, covers the majority of Earth's surface, and sustains all known life forms. The water cycle, driven by the sun's energy, transports water from the oceans to the skies and back again, ensuring a continuous supply of freshwater for all living beings.
